ECON 4800  
Intermediate Macroeconomics



Prerequisites:  ECON 3001 Mathematics for Economists

Course description:    Analysis of the factors that influence national income, long-run economic growth, unemployment, and inflation.  Using various macroeconomic models, students develop the anlystic tools and insights required to evaluate  the sources of business cycle fluctuations.  The impacts of fiscal and monetary policy decisions are emphasized..


Course offerings:  Fall semester
